Kara’s Korner A Message from your Children’s Pastor
I’m back and boy have things changed! Gary and I love, love, love being parents. I never thought I would find such joy in burps, bowel movements, and spit up! Gary and I rejoice when Judah burps within 5 minutes, and are so glad when he goes potty! Judah is an abso-lute delight. He makes my heart smile. The kids at Crossroads have given Judah the best Welcome.
The Kidz Ministry team has an exciting year planned for your kids! When looking at events for this budgeted year, I made a decision to cut the Eggstravanganza event. I
wanted to make sure that every event or activity we invest in for our kids had a mission and was fruitful. I truly believe that while the Egg hunt was fun, it didn’t do anything but create a 30 sec. environment of swooping up as many eggs as possible. So, we will be applying that money into other events that will bring kids into our great services. During Spring Break, we will have a Spring Break Bash for our kidmotion kids in the gym. This will be a great time for the kids to invite friends and hang out with the kidz ministry staff.
We also have many fun services planned for June and July. In June, we will focus on “bring-a-friend” to church. July will once again be “themed Sun-days.” There will be big prizes to give away this summer in kidz church!
In June, we are also going to have a special 3 day camp for our preschoolers only! And there will be a playdate scheduled for our babies and preschool-ers and parents in May.
I am excited about the upcoming kidz ministry events and hope you will watch for sign ups and more details!

For the Month of March, we are
continuing our study over the
Fruits of the Spirit.
Sunday, March 7: God measures
a man’s strength by his self-
control. We will look at the verse
Romans 6:12 which reads, “Let not
sin reign in your body.” Spiritual
strength should be more desired
than physical might and ability.
Sunday, March 14: God defends
the longsuffering believer. The
world teaches that we should get
even with those who wrong us.
However, the story of Saul and
David teaches that God takes care
of the Righteous.
Sunday, March 21: Though
Christ was infinitely strong, He
was gentle in His dealings with
man. Ephesians 4:32 says, “Be ye
kind one to another.” Gentleness is
truly a sign of great strength.
Sunday, March 28: God is al-
ways good. Acts 10:38 says that
“Jesus went about doing good.”
Goodness is our nature in Jesus
Christ. We must, as Jesus did,
demonstrate God’s goodness to
others.
BABIES ON BOARD-Blooming in the Son!
In the 10 - 18 mo. room, babies
are learning that Jesus loves them
and their family. The babies will
learn about Jesus riding on the
donkey and the children praising
him on Palm Sunday, March 28.
19 - 23 mo. room, we are learning
that God cares for us and watches
over us during the daytime, night-
time, and wherever we are. Mrs.
Mary will send home the song the
babies are learning in class. The
babies are also learning that God
sent His son Jesus to tell us how
much He loves us.
In the 2 year old class, our ba-
bies are learning about some of
the healing miracles that Jesus
did. Jesus healed the paralytic
whose friends let him down the
roof to Jesus, the lady with the
issue of blood, Bartimeaus' blind
eyes, and Jairus' sick daughter.
The 2 year olds will be learning 1
Peter 2:24, “By Jesus' stripes
we're healed.”

For the month of March, the
Training Wheels kids will be cele-
brating Jesus’ Death and Resur-
rection.
Week 1: Hosanna Day ( Jesus enters Jerusalem on a donkey)
Week 2: A Special Meal (The last supper)
Week 3: In the Garden (Jesus
prays in the garden)
Week 4: Jesus died and rose again.
The memory verse is: “We believe that Jesus died and rose again.”
1 Thessalonians 4:14.
On Easter Sunday, April 4, the pre-schoolers will have a special service in the opening ceremony room.
